Brunei - Import of Styrene-Acrylonitrile (SAN) Copolymers
Since 2014, Brunei Import of Styrene-Acrylonitrile (SAN) Copolymers increased 70.4% year on year. With $1,825.16 in 2019, the country was ranked number 121 among other countries in Import of Styrene-Acrylonitrile (SAN) Copolymers. Brunei is overtaken by Bolivia, which was ranked number 120 at $1,900.44 and is followed by Senegal at $1,290.7. China ranked the highest with $470,262,161.86 in 2019, that is +0.5% compared to 2018. Thailand, Germany and Indonesia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Honduras witnessed the best average annual growth at +306.8% per year, while Kuwait recorded the worst performance at -81.7% per year.
